Publisher description

'I Want My Life Back' 15 Questions You Must Ask Yourself In Order to Regain The Life You Were Intended to Have After Breaking Free From the Spirit of Lack and Poverty is the sequel to 'Who Stole My Life' 30 Questions You Must Ask Yourself In Recognizing the Spirit of Lack and Poverty and How to Break Free. Once again, 'I Want My Life Back' is a book of self realization, not self help. The book guides you through 15 additional questions that will help you repair the destructive mindsets, negative emotions and past hurts you have collected, allowed or had thrust on you since childhood. It is said, that when we are children and at our purest we know exactly who we are, we are living our authentic selves. It is only through conditioning by our families, teachers, and peers that we become untrue to who we are in order to conform to the so called status quo. (this is why the Bible says, be not conformed to this world but through the renewing of your mind...Romans 12:2) In other words, "To thine own self be true"! Daily we need to check our 'authentic meter' to see where we are and if we need to make any adjustments to stay the course. As adults, we are left with limiting beliefs about ourselves, circumstances and money that cripple us. We try all the self help products, seminars, and whatever else we find that we think will help us break free from the bondages we find ourselves in. My endeavor is not to exclude anyone in this message of healing and breaking those things that keep us as a society and as the human race bound. My goal is that through this book everyone finds the path to freedom from those things holding you in bondage, namely the 'spirit of poverty'
